Abstract

The paper examines the correlation between artificial intelligence (AI) and digital human resource management (HRM), their impact on sustainable development. It explores the growing importance of sustainable HRM and its integration within business processes. The study investigates how AI and digital HRM contribute to sustainable HRM practices and analyses influencing factors. It has been proven that many companies are wary of AI and digital HRM impact on sustainable HRM, facing integration challenges. The conclusions reveal that AI and digital HRM help addressing social issues spreading in today’s world. Large corporations strive to implement them to achieve sustainable development goals. Strategic HRM focuses on strategy and human resources, while sustainable HRM emphasizes the connection between sustainability and HRM practices. To gain a deeper understanding of digital HRM, a survey on “People’s vulnerability to human trafficking and exploitation in the context of war” was conducted. The findings show AI’s potential to influence societal behaviour, highlighting its importance in shaping sustainable HRM. The practical implications of this research can aid enterprises in stabilizing their resource consumption. Economic growth, social inclusion, and environmental protection are essential interconnected elements for achieving sustainable development and ensuring the wellbeing of individuals and society.
